For 4x4 H/T 265/60R18 tyres

Other than Michelin, Bridgestone, BFGoodrich. Which other brand/model for H/T tyres is good?

Currently using michelin primacy suv but sabah tyre price is kinda crazy now (shops in west malaysia doesn't seem want to do postage to sabah too) and those michelins are probably close to rm1k per pc here. I'm interested in continentals (i love the CC6 on my other cars) but haven't seen it in the shops here yet. Just plan to get something cheaper than michelins but still runs well, I'm lightfooted and doesn't drive aggressively, mostly around 80/90km/h max, majority on highways.

Toyo open country u/t, Yokohama geolandar g015 a/t (more biased towards HT), Dunlop rt5

Much cheaper than your primacy suv but lousier. You have to decide as tyres are always a compromise
